3. Make an exact copy

It wasn't long ago that losing the car key wasn't a big deal. You could find a duplicate for less than $10 at your local hardware store. Today, however, things are a bit more complicated. Many modern cars have keys that lock and turns on the car as well as controls a variety of vehicle functions.

Those are much more costly to replace, particularly in the event that you don't own an extra key. The good news is that if you have roadside assistance coverage and your insurance company will send a locksmith to make the new key for you. You will be responsible for the cost of a new key.

Another option is to visit the dealership where you bought your car and see whether they are able to create an original copy for you. It's more expensive than having a locksmith create copies, but it is a possible option. It could be difficult to locate a locksmith that is qualified to work on your specific type of car key, dependent on the model. This is why having a spare key at home is always a good idea.
